On Monday on this blog, we talked about narrowing our list of books to be discussed at our Library’s Mock Newbery Discussion and Election. We posted a link to a survey to allow YOU to vote for the books which YOU thought should be discussed. In addition to the 54 titles on our survey, we also offered the option of “Write-In Votes.”
I’m pleased to say there have already been eleven write-ins. They are:
- After Eli by Rebecca Rupp
- Child of the Mountains by Marilyn Sue Shank
- Dreamsleeves by Coleen Murtagh Paratore
- The False Prince by Jennifer A. Nielsen
- In a Glass Grimmly by Adam Gidwitz
- Jepp, Who Defied the Stars by Katherine Marsh
- Laugh with the Moon by Shana Burg
- One for the Murphys by Lynda Mullaly Hunt
- Precious Bones by Mika Ashley-Hollinger
- Unfortunate Son by Constance Leeds
- Ungifted by Gordon Korman
Unfortunately, we cannot add these titles to the survey without losing all the current votes. Please feel free to write in these titles or others which you feel should be included in our discussion AND which meet the Newbery criteria as you complete your survey.
And remember to register for our annual Mock Newbery discussion and election where we will be discussing the 15 titles selected! The discussion will be held on Saturday, January 12, from 2:00 to 3:30pm at the Main Library in downtown Fort Wayne.
